Venturi Meter Flow Rate
A venturi infers flow from the pressure drop as the fluid speeds up through its throat — a low-loss flow meter.
The flow is Q = C_d·A·√(2·Δp/ρ). where C_d is the discharge coefficient, A the throat area, Δp the pressure drop and ρ the density.

The venturi recovers most of its pressure downstream, so it loses far less energy than an orifice plate for the same measurement.
